Once the party was at its full fledged state, I strongly suggested to Skye that we split up to find the Rick hyena guy. He wasn't ready to oblige but I stood rooted to the ground, not budging with my decision either.

Skye must have gotten the hint that I needed my space because he went the other way. It was true. I needed this space. I needed to stay away from him for the time being.

The revelation inside my brain gave me the jitters and I just wanted to close my eyes to forget everything. All of it.

Finding a lone wall, I leaned against it and looked up at the sparkling chandelier on the ceiling. It was really attractive and I found myself studying it absent-mindedly. Its precision, intricacy and all the stuff dangling on it.

After gazing upwards for a really long time, I averted my vision and looked ahead. When I did, I saw Skye waving at me frantically. It was then that I noticed him with another man. His protruding belly gave me an idea of who he was.

I quickly walked toward them, fisting my huge dress and faced Rick just as I reached them. "He's telling me that our guy's not here," Skye informed me, not beating around the bush. "He bailed out at the last minute."

"But why?!" I all but shouted. When I received some odd looks, I sent them all an apologetic smile. "Why?" I whispered angrily this time.

Rick, who seemed like he managed to assemble all different types of clothing to wear for this event, looked almost frustrated. He stood out like a sore thumb.

"Because he got the whiff that you'll be attending. Wait a minute. If you're Valerie then why are your pictures on the internet captioned as "April Glow"?" Rick asked dubiously.

I stilled because I forgot to pretend like April at that moment. What was even more agitating was that my pictures as April were already being circulated everywhere. I can already imagine the newspapers with our pictures together as well.

I started breathing normally again when I felt Skye's hand wrapping around mine comfortingly. "That's because she is April Glow. I told her everything about what happened."

"Seriously?" Rick scrunched his nose as if disgusted. "You really want me to believe that? I am a journalist. We are professional liars. You gotta be a better liar than that. Besides, I'd seen you staring at your ladylove the other day-" He smirked at me. "-and that's the same way you've been staring at her," he finished, satisfied before pointing at me.

"What way?"

"Stop with your nonsense!"

Skye soon followed after me and we both glanced at each other.

"Ooh, this is gonna be something juicy for me again," Rick spoke up, drumming his fingers together and giving us a nasty look.

"Go ahead, Rick. I bet you'd want the whole world to know about your pervy fantasies and the types of pictures you click," Skye gritted and I stared at him with wide eyes.

Eww, I thought and took a few steps away to keep my distance from the disgusting hyena and clung more onto Skye.

"Wh-what?" He stuttered, all the color draining from his face.

"You heard me." Skye smirked and fished something out from inside his suit jacket and flashed it in front of his face. He was about to sneakily snatch it but Skye was quicker and pocketed it again. "Ah-ah, not so fast."

"What the hell, man?! Please!" Rick looked frantic now with the way his huge, bulbous eyes shifted back and forth from Skye to me.

"No and if you reveal the truth to anyone that she's Valerie," Skye said before pausing for a second. Wrapping an arm around my waist, he pulled me to his side and continued, "Then I won't hesitate to put you behind the bars. Remember, it'll even squash your Pulitzer dreams."

Skye looked so dangerous but I was mesmerized by how controlled he seemed to be. How everything was in his hands and he knew it. His arm around my waist didn't help either because I could feel my chest thumping as if it was a trampoline and someone's jumping on it.

Rick scowled at us but he knew that he lost the battle as his body hunched forward with a loud huff.

"Tada." I waggled my fingers in a wave and gave him a laughing smile. "The joke's on you, hyena."

With one last glare, he trudged toward the exit and I finally turned to Skye. I expected him to take off his arm from around me but he kept it there fearlessly. Truth be said, I secretly liked it even when my head seemed like it was drowning in the deep waters.

"What was that about?" I queried, honestly oblivious to that small chip and its contents.

"Let's just say that I'd managed to steal his memory card the other day in D.C.. You know, when I had threatened to break his camera." Skye snorted and looked down at me.

Chuckling, I started glancing around me to avoid his eye contact. "So you went through his stuff, huh?" I remarked, recalling his comment toward hyena's "pervy pictures".

"Don't even remind me. He's a sick man," Skye replied with a pinched face. It was as if he might throw up any time soon. I giggled and he just shook his head with a small smile. "The only reason I'd gone through it was because I thought that he might have your pictures from that day in D.C.. My intentions were to delete them and that I did, but my eyes lost their purity as soon as they landed on some... voyeuristic ones." My heart stilled for a second but he assured me with his next words. "They weren't yours though thankfully."

Sighing in relief, I lowered my head. I started feeling something and I was about to find another reason to keep my distance from him when his fingers tenderly touched a loose tendril behind my ear.

"Are you okay?" He whispered.

I took a step back, a sign for him to take off his arm from around me which he thankfully understood. However I felt a pang in my chest when I saw the discreet hurt in his eyes. "I'm all good."

We were brought out of our trance when a voice interrupted us. "Is that you... Skye?"

Skye reluctantly pulled his gaze away from me and I turned to my side to see an old man in a crisp suit. I didn't recognize him but the thinning hair on his head was quite perceptible and also the first thing to catch my attention, especially in a mask.

"Mr. Miller?" Was Skye's confused reply. That's when it dawned on me that he's Joseph Miller, one of the directors of Skye's company.

"Yes, son." Joseph laughed heartily and shook hands with Skye.

I just watched their interaction absent-mindedly. Mr. Miller looked at me questioningly. I was caught a bit off guard by the frown etched on his face.

"Is that... Valerie?" He finally asked.

I had to literally look away to not roll my eyes out of instinct. That's when I noticed a guy staring at me with a wide smile. I could tell what was the cause of all this attention. My dress was fanned around me too much to not attract a few eyes.

Looking away from him in annoyance, I turned back to Mr. Miller with a forced polite smile. "I am April Glow," I introduced myself in my practiced Welsh accent and he recoiled back in surprise.

It just took him a few seconds though because he was convinced that I was someone else entirely. "Why, you look beautiful, Ms. Glow," he complimented me with a huge grin.

I passed him another phony smile, not interested in talking to him. I don't understand the concept that why does everybody choose the exact moment to compliment you when you know you're at your best? Nobody tried to compliment me when I was at my lowest, when everybody was pasting my pictures everywhere, saying bad things about me? Didn't they even for a fleeting second think that I might need a moment or something even remotely close to good when I was falling into an abyss. Why does the world uplift the already uplifted people and push down the already casted off ones?

Ever since I saw Mr. Miller being rude to Skye in the meeting room, I've envisioned him to be one of those pompous old men with an old-fashioned way of thinking.

I realized that I had spaced out, losing some part of their conversation but tuned back in when something caught my ears. "I am so sorry for how it turned out to be but it was a unanimous decision by the Board," Mr. Miller spoke empathetically and patted Skye's arm gently.

"I am good, Joe. Don't fret over it. C'est la vie." They both laughed at that and I was mesmerized at how beautiful Skye's French accent sounded.

Mr. Miller gave him one last pat on the shoulder and began milling around in the crowd. Pun intended.

I was about to ask him the burning question when he beat me to it with an amused smile. "I still can't get over your Welsh accent. Like you don't even sound like you." He said 'you' in a hushed whisper.

I chewed on my lip to suppress a blushing smile as my eyes caught onto the shimmering sparkles on my dress. Just as I was about to drift into that "shy" phase, I remembered my question. Looking at him seriously, I asked, "What was that?" I pointed a finger toward Miller's direction discreetly.

Skye's playful mood all but vanished. The gleam just completely disappeared from his face as if he wanted to run in the opposite direction.

"What?" He asked, trying to stall. It was quite evident with the way he was working his jaws.

"What was that?" I repeated slowly. "What did he mean by "a unanimous decision", Skye?" I knew that it was something related to our pictures flying everywhere.

He opened his mouth to answer when I felt someone's tap on my shoulder. I turned around to see a guy who seemed to be about Skye's age, smiling at me softly. He seemed cute with his dark curly hair, green eyes and soft features. However I couldn't make out much because of his mask.

"Hey," he said, his voice really low and soft. I frowned because I was actually anticipating to hear Skye's answer. My hard expression somewhat loosened a bit when he didn't stop smiling.

"Hello," I greeted him and was actually surprised that I remembered to keep my Welsh accent. Tucking my upper lip in confusion because I couldn't remember seeing him before, I glanced at Skye over my shoulder who was already scowling at the guy. When he felt my eyes on him, he shrugged as if to say he didn't know him.

"I am Cameron." I heard the guy say. "And you must be April Glow? Everyone seems to be talking about you," he told me with a sheepish grin.

"Oh. Oh, yeah." I chuckled awkwardly. I don't know why he approached me but an idea was starting to formulate in my head. If he wanted to have a conversation with the enigmatic April Glow then so be it. Taking the advantage, I might even ask him about this incognito man, Kyle M.

"Would you like to dance with me?" He asked me shyly, scratching his eyebrow. On any other day, I would have politely declined his offer but right now, I wanted to find out more about the host of this event. I was ready to take my chances.

I started smiling at him but Cameron's face quickly fell. He wasn't looking at me but behind me. I tilted the upper half of my body to glance at Skye again but he began whistling a tune all of a sudden. His hands were shoved in his pockets while his eyes were roaming everywhere but us.

I had forgotten all about Skye standing right behind me. For some reason, my heart felt like I was betraying him. I wanted to dance with him.

I turned back around to face Cameron but he seemed scared out of his wits. "You know what? Never mind. I was just joking." He was about to bolt off but I caught onto his wrist.

"Wait," I ordered but I was glad that it wasn't too brash.

Cameron was surprised but he passed me a tentative grin. Intimidated still, he looked behind me, probably at Skye and all the color from his face drained in an instant.

Exhaling in agitation, I fully turned toward Skye with my hands on my hips. He quickly averted his eyes and whistled another random tune. "I am dancing with you, Cameron." I said with a tone of finality, all the while looking at Skye.

Skye stopped whistling altogether and gave me a hard look. However it went away as soon as it came. He shrugged and winked at me before walking away.

"Well, that was intense," Cameron mumbled.

I felt another pang in my chest because I didn't want to dance with this guy at the cost of making Skye walk away. I wanted to call him back but I pushed that urge away.

"Shall we, Ms. Glow?" Cameron asked, coming in front of me and offering his hand to me flirtatiously.

Good. I groaned internally. That's the last thing I want right now.

A soft melody started playing and I followed Cameron toward the ball court at the center of the huge room. My eyes fell on the stage ahead but the band was wearing elegant masks and I couldn't recognize anyone. Whoever they were, they were really good because I was lost in the soft rhythm.

I was brought out of my reverie when Cameron snaked an arm around my waist while holding my hand with the other as I put my free hand on his shoulder.

An unfamiliar song was playing and we swayed to it along with the other couples. I had purposely pushed Cameron to the side to not be the center of attention. This wasn't a romantic dance for me. That's when I felt guilty because I felt like I was using him for my benefit.

"Look, Cameron... uh-"

"Call me Cam." He smiled.

"Right, Cam. I just... I wanna let you know that I am not interested... in... you," I tried to keep my tone as gentle as I could, which was hard because I didn't want to hurt his feelings.

I watched his reaction closely but he didn't seem so fazed by it. "I know." He nodded his head.

"Oh." I sighed in relief. "I am sorry."

"Don't be. I just thought that you looked so pretty and wanted to ask you for a dance. Didn't really think about your date actually. God, I sound so corny, don't I?" He laughed shyly and looked away.

"I don't think so." I beamed. "It's all right. Where's your date? Or... you don't have one?" I questioned but I knew how intruding that sounded. Though it didn't matter anymore because I couldn't take it back.

"I do but since I don't have any girlfriend or anything, my best friend volunteered to tag along with me. Her name's Chloe," he explained to me, embarrassed.

"Do one thing, Cam. As soon as our dance is over, go over to Chloe and ask her for a dance. Hell, even ask her out by the end of the night," I suggested, wiggling my eyebrows.

"Wh-what?" He choked on his spit and I rubbed his back. Regaining his composure back, he looked at me uneasily. "Why-why would you say that?!"

"Because I have a feeling that Chloe clearly likes you. I mean she helped you out by being your date..." I trailed off.

"I don't think-"

"You have got nothing to lose. She might be your best friend but nobody in their right mind would attend this boring event, best friend or not." As soon as I said those words, I glanced around for Skye. He was sulking at the buffet table and eating muffins like his life depended on it.

"You like him." It wasn't a question.

I shrugged, not wanting to admit it.

"I'd actually thought that he was with this Valerie chick. Kinda shipped them." He looked at my face and continued quickly, "No offense though. You guys look pretty good too!"

"Don't worry about it." I smiled at him earnestly. "Anywho, how'd you get the invite to this event?"

"My dad's in the business world. He gets it all the time. But... eh, he couldn't make it so here I am," he answered truthfully..

"Um... so, you don't know who the host of this party, Kyle M., is?"

"Wait, I know him. But like, not really, you know?"

"No, I don't. Elaborate."

"Okay, so I know him because this Kyle guy always organizes such events. Like almost two to three times a year. We get each and every invite to attend his parties. And honestly, he's a hit in doing all of this," he spoke, waving his fingers all around.

I furrowed my brows and narrowed my eyes. "I am sensing a but here."

"Yeah that's because there is. Nobody knows who Kyle is and he started doing this just a few years ago. He always says that he's gonna show up, you know, to do the host stuff and all but here's the thing. He never does. Everybody literally just comes here in the hopes that one day, he'll stop with his pranks and show us his face. Let me tell you, though, that his parties are extravagant." He chuckled.

The wheels in my mind started churning at once. "Then I don't think he would be showing up today either," I said it more to myself than Cameron but he heard it anyway.

"Hmm? How can you be so sure?" He seemed bewildered now.

"Just a hunch." I paused, contemplating my next words. "Then did no one ever think that it might be a pseudonym?"

"Trust me, we think that. Because it doesn't even make sense, right? Like you have to be rich enough to be holding such expensive events at such expensive venues. If you have so much money, your name has to shine out in the business world."

"Agreed." I nodded my head slowly in understanding. "Meaning it could be anyone. They might even be attending this yet no one would know. I bet Kyle M is present here but as his real person." I smirked as if I just solved a murder case.

"It could be possible. Who knows, right? Why do you think my father always sends me here? He loves a good mystery," Cameron finished, laughing in the end.

I just smiled at him, feeling triumphant all of a sudden. It could be Ms. Maxwell but in such a heavy crowd, I couldn't even spot her. Maybe she could, she just has those sharp senses. Or maybe, it could be someone else entirely. Someone who Ms. Maxwell hired.

The song came to an end and Cameron soon left after hugging me but he kept his distance which I was grateful for.

A new song came on but this time it was soothing, almost like enjoying a moment on a beach with waves crashing against the shore.

"You wouldn't mind if I wrap my arms around you, would you?" His deep voice whispered in my ear huskily. A delightful shiver ran down my spine. "And have this dance with you," he murmured from behind me.

I didn't dare to look at him but I could feel my heart at peace by just hearing his voice. His fingers lightly grazed on my waist and he wounded his arms around me, all the while circling to stand in front of me.

"Would you?" Skye repeated.

"I would," I joked but smiled nonetheless. I felt like I might even cry with all the emotions brewing inside of me.

"That broken path,
didn't mislead me,
but helped me to find yours.
A token of wrath,
hadn't stopped me,
but helped me to close all the wrong doors.
Turn around, call me back.
Hold my hand 'cause I'm done seeing black."

To hide my oncoming blush, I buried my face in his chest. I had to do that because his intense gaze was pulling at my heart strings in a good way, of course and I didn't know what to think of that.

"Let go of all the problems,
That are breaking our strings.
Keep me dancing,
'Til I can't breathe.
Just one look in your eyes,
I've forgotten all the lines.
Hold me close, got no remorse,
For you've become,
That chosen path."

I still had my face hidden when his chest rumbled with laughter. A smile of my own grew up on my lips.

Skye lifted up my chin and I was lost in his pools of gray like always. "I am sorry."

Tightening my arms around him, I swayed to the beautiful song and smiled up at him. It was my way of forgiving him. It was my way of hiding the realness behind my feelings so that he wouldn't know.

It's true. I love Skye Williams.

"Running through the field of meadows,
Glistening like the cute, little dewdrops,
are your beautiful eyes.
Quicker than the river flows,
beats my heart,
like you own it.
For you've become,
My only path."

"Did I tell you how beautiful you look tonight? No wait, that came out wrong. You always look... beautiful," he told me confidently but a light dusk of pink was coating his cheeks.

I pursed my lips to hide my smile. "Did I tell you how dapper you look tonight? But oh, wait, there's no point because you always look... debonair."

"Are you flirting with me, Ms. Glow?" He began smirking slowly and holy schmuck, did he look really beautiful at that moment.

"Sure." I winked. Sure, I could blame and hide behind this "Glow" personality but still be able to speak the truth.

The song ended but I didn't want this breathtaking moment to end so soon. Our moment. I wanted to be wrapped up like this in his arms forever. Skye glanced toward the stage and gave a two finger salute to the singer who did the same.

"You know him?" But Skye just flicked my forehead lightly.

I don't know what I was doing but it was like my body had a mind of its own. I hugged Skye and this time without listening to my restraining side. God, does it feel so good. I felt ignited when he did the same before placing his head on top of mine.
